House Foundation Leveling in Columbus, OH
House foundation leveling services address uneven or sinking foundations that can cause structural issues in residential properties. This service typically involves assessing the foundation’s condition, then using specialized techniques such as mudjacking or piering to restore the foundation to a stable, level position. Projects often include correcting uneven floors, repairing cracks in walls or ceilings, and preventing further settlement that could compromise the integrity of the home. Homeowners interested in foundation leveling should understand the extent of the foundation’s movement, the underlying causes, and the most appropriate method to achieve a long-lasting solution.
Property owners usually request foundation leveling when noticing signs like c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, or uneven flooring. Before requesting services, it’s helpful to evaluate the history of soil movement in the area, any previous foundation issues, and the severity of the current condition. Clear communication about the specific concerns and visible symptoms can assist in determining the right approach. Understanding these factors can ensure the selected solution effectively addresses the problem and maintains the home’s stability over time.

Common House Foundation Leveling Jobs
House foundation leveling involves adjusting and stabilizing the foundation to prevent uneven settling.
Slab foundation leveling addresses uneven or cracked concrete slabs in residential properties.
Pier and beam leveling corrects shifting or sagging beams to ensure structural stability.
Foundation repair for sinking helps restore the proper height and alignment of the home’s base.
Uneven floor correction reduces creaks, cracks, and uneven surfaces caused by foundation issues.
Crack repair and sealing helps prevent water intrusion and further foundation damage.
House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es a house to need foundation leveling? Shifts in soil, moisture changes, and settling over time can lead to uneven foundations requiring leveling services.
How can I tell if my home needs foundation leveling?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, doors or windows that stick, and visible cracks in the foundation or exterior walls.
What types of foundation issues are addressed with leveling services? Common problems include settling, sinking, and uneven slabs or pier and beam foundations that impact the home's stability.
Is foundation leveling suitable for all types of homes? It is typically effective for most residential foundations experiencing unevenness or settling issues.
